Brian Shroder, the head of Binance's US branch, resigned amid regulatory challenges. Norman Reed, the Chief Legal Officer, is now the interim CEO. This follows the company's recent layoffs, and they are facing legal issues, including SEC allegations, which they deny.

>>56090797
Charges include operating unregistered exchanges, broker-dealers, and clearing agencies; misrepresenting trading controls and oversight on the Binance.US platform; and the unregistered offer and sale of securities. These are all headaches.
